In March 1964, Mary Theresa Simpson walked home through Elmira, New York and vanished. Detectives interviewed 300 people. No suspect was ever charged. The case file grew for six decades. The killer lived in the same city, raised a family, and died in 2004 without a single question ever being asked of him. This investigation examines how a 2022 grant application, a forensic laboratory in Texas, 0.4 nanograms of biological material surviving in a police department freezer, and a FedEx package stranded in a Memphis ice storm converged — after 61 years — to finally name Alfred Raymond Murray Jr.: Korean War veteran, Elmira grandfather, convicted by a dead man's exhumed DNA. What the Elmira Police detectives preserved in 1964 — without knowing what DNA was — became the evidence that broke the case in 2026.
